Perancangan Sistem Administrasi Barang Berbasis Web Menggunakan Model Pengembangan Sistem RAD

PT Grandspot Cipta Solusi is a company engaged in the field of information technology which focuses on leasing systems and hardware for call centers. The recording of hardware data is still done manually through Excel media files. The current manual recording method is less effective and efficient and has the potential for data discrepancies and loss of goods. Therefore, we need a system that can help work so that it becomes more effective and efficient. The system development model used in designing this system is Rapid Application Development or RAD. Rapid Application Development is a fast system development method that usually takes 60 to 90 days. There are 4 stages in this method, namely: 1) Requirement Planning stage, 2) Design, 3) Construct, 4) Cutover. Entity Relationship Diagram is a depiction of a database conceptual design that represents the relationship between objects in the real world. PostgreSQL is one of the database software that has been actively developed to date and has been tested for its reliability. PHP is a programming language that can be integrated with HTML. The Goods Administration System is a system designed to help the user's work. With the creation of this system, it can make it easier for users to record existing hardware and make it easier for users to make reports addressed to superiors. In addition, recording also becomes more organized so that the user's work becomes more effective and efficient.
